The life history traits of organisms have evolved in relation to all of the following, except

A
Darwinian fitness
B
organisms evolving under selection pressure developed by environmental factors
C
organisms achieving most efficient reproductive strategy
D
loss of energy from one trophic level to another.

Share this question

For Instagram sharing, use “Apps” on mobile or copy the link.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ts
The correct answer is:
D

Population of organisms evolves to maximise their reproductive fitness, i.e. Darwinian fitness in the habitat in which they live. Under a particular set of selection pressures organisms evolve towards most efficient reproductive strategy. Life history traits of organisms have evolved in relation to the constraints imposed by components of habitat in which they live. However loss of energy does not relate to evolving populations.
